Summary
Malicious code in tronkeyspy (PyPI)
Details

-= Per source details. Do not edit below this line.=-

Source: kam193 (762c52ac89d263a12b871d89f8eda658aaa6cc433251fb764ccc55d28e94f1e1)

Package appears to be designed for private key exfiltration, but no known usage. The name appears to be related to the cryptocurrency TRX (Tron / Tronix). Some packages additionally clone the readme of other, legit libraries. The similar packages are repeating uploaded to PyPI


Category: MALICIOUS - The campaign has clearly malicious intent, like infostealers.

Campaign: 2025-04-tronix

Reasons (based on the campaign):

  • exfiltration-generic

  • crypto-related
